West Virginia baseball was coal and river baseball. The Mountain State League of the late 1930s fielded the Welch Miners, the Beckley Bengals, and the Williamson Red Birds in the southern coalfields, while the river cities held their own: Wheeling, whose Stogies took their name from the city's famous cigars, plus Charleston and Huntington along the Ohio and Kanawha.
